The strategy outlined for automating IT services work through AI implementation is comprehensive and systematic. It begins with identifying and prioritizing automation opportunities, such as conducting an audit to map current IT processes. Repetitive tasks are ideal candidates for automation, and gathering stakeholder feedback is crucial. For example, a team might audit help desk support tasks to identify which can be automated, saving time and resources.
Next, the strategy focuses on implementing AI-driven automation solutions. After selecting the right AI tools, customized workflows are developed and integrated into existing IT frameworks. A pilot test is essential to ensure the system's functionality. For instance, automating server maintenance tasks could be piloted to monitor its efficiency before full deployment.
Finally, the strategy includes evaluating and optimizing automation effectiveness. Setting up key performance indicators (KPIs) helps in measuring success. Regular reviews and staying updated with new AI advancements ensure continuous improvement. Optimization might include refining AI algorithms to better predict user needs or improve system responsiveness.

⛳️ Strategy 1: Identify and prioritise automation opportunities
- Conduct an audit to map current IT processes
- Identify repetitive and rule-based tasks suitable for automation
- Engage with stakeholders to gather feedback on potential areas for automation
- Prioritise processes based on impact and feasibility for automation
- Assess current technology stack for automation compatibility
- Define clear objectives and expected outcomes for automation efforts
- Research potential AI tools and platforms to support automation
- Establish a budget for automation initiatives
- Develop a roadmap with timelines for implementing automation solutions
- Set up a team responsible for managing the automation project
⛳️ Strategy 2: Implement AI-driven automation solutions
- Select appropriate AI tools and platforms based on the prioritised automation opportunities
- Develop customised automation scripts or workflows
- Integrate AI solutions within existing IT infrastructure
- Conduct a pilot test of the automation solution to ensure functionality
- Monitor and analyse pilot test results for accuracy and efficiency
- Seek feedback from users interacting with the automated processes
- Refine automation solutions based on pilot feedback
- Conduct training sessions for staff to effectively use new AI tools
- Fully deploy automation solutions across prioritised areas
- Establish a process for ongoing monitoring and maintenance of AI solutions
⛳️ Strategy 3: Evaluate and optimise automation effectiveness
- Define key performance indicators (KPIs) for evaluating automation success
- Regularly collect data on the performance of automated processes
- Assess cost savings and productivity improvements from automation
- Conduct regular reviews and updates to automation processes as needed
- Implement feedback loops for continuous improvement of AI solutions
- Regularly engage with stakeholders to understand their evolving needs
- Stay updated with new AI technologies and advancements
- Benchmark automation performance against industry standards
- Optimise AI configurations to enhance process efficiency
- Celebrate successes and communicate benefits across the organisation
